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

We wanted to stay in the Le Marais area of Paris and this hotel was well located. To places like Musee d'Orsay and Notre Dame we took an Uber -- but the more adventurous could walk or figure out the Metro. We stayed 2 nights, walked the Marais area with its delightful nooks and crannies, enjoyed dinners in bistros. Breakfasts were fine and to our taste; there is an elevator; A/C works, bed studio concept was excellent for making coffee in the morning and refrigerating water and wine. We liked the concept of having a code to access the building and our room -- there is also a concierge on duty but we liked not having to check in/out with a front desk.
